So I had my upper & lower radiator hoses replaced today and a coolant flush as well. The invoice shows that they used what is called a Gold Universal Antifreeze. Is this safe in my 2001 Park Ave ?
 
You should call them and ask what brand did they use.
I'm actually going back next week to have my rear coilovers replaced. I'll ask him . I did notice that my engine is running 8 degrees cooler since the change . Upon research I had read that gold coolant is generally HOAT/OAT certified . Perhaps they're specifically using this coolant because it gets hot AF here in Vegas. Needless to say I'll ask what brand and if it's HOAT/OAT certified . Thank you
 
Consider also adding some Water Wetter. It helps by breaking the surface tension of the coolant to allow for better contact and therefore more heat transfer.
